How To Make the Cheesy Garlic Butter Chicken Bites with Rigatoni in Alfredo Sauce

Step 1: Prep the Chicken

Cut the chicken breasts into bite-sized pieces. Season with salt, pepper, and Italian seasoning. Dredge each piece in a mix of panko breadcrumbs and grated Parmesan for that golden crust.

Step 2: Sear the Chicken Bites

Heat olive oil and butter in a skillet. Sear chicken pieces in batches over medium-high heat until golden and cooked through. Set aside and keep warm.

Step 3: Cook the Rigatoni

Boil a large pot of salted water. Cook the rigatoni until al dente, according to package instructions. Drain and reserve a bit of pasta water.

Step 4: Make the Alfredo Sauce

In a saucepan, melt butter and sauté minced garlic until fragrant. Pour in heavy cream and simmer gently. Stir in grated Parmesan until fully melted and creamy. Adjust thickness with reserved pasta water if needed.

Step 5: Assemble and Serve

Toss the cooked rigatoni in the Alfredo sauce. Arrange the crispy chicken bites over the pasta. Sprinkle with red pepper flakes and chopped parsley.


Serving and Storing Cheesy Garlic Butter Chicken Bites with Rigatoni

This dish is best served immediately while the Alfredo sauce is velvety and warm and the chicken is at its crispiest. Plate generously, and garnish with additional Parmesan or parsley if desired. For a fresh contrast, pair with a crisp Caesar salad or roasted vegetables.

To store leftovers, transfer to an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 3 days. When reheating, add a splash of milk or cream to the pasta to revive the sauce’s creaminess. Reheat in a skillet over low heat for the best texture.


Frequently Asked Questions

How can I make this dish gluten-free?

Use gluten-free pasta and substitute the panko breadcrumbs with gluten-free breadcrumbs. Double-check your Parmesan and seasoning blends to ensure they’re gluten-free as well.

Can I use a different cut of chicken?

Absolutely. Boneless chicken thighs work beautifully and offer even more juiciness. Just adjust cooking time accordingly.

What can I use instead of heavy cream?

You can substitute with half-and-half or a mix of whole milk and butter, but the sauce may be slightly less rich.

Can this dish be made ahead?

Yes, but for best results, prepare the components separately and combine right before serving. Store the chicken and pasta in separate containers.

How do I keep the chicken crispy?

Avoid covering the chicken after cooking, and reheat uncovered in the oven or air fryer to maintain that crunch.

What wine pairs well with this meal?

A crisp Chardonnay or a light Pinot Grigio complements the creamy sauce and garlic-forward chicken beautifully.

Cheesy Garlic Butter Chicken Bites with Rigatoni in Alfredo Sauce

Cheesy Garlic Butter Chicken Bites with Rigatoni in Alfredo Sauce


  • Author: Julia Koch
  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ings

Description

Cheesy Garlic Butter Chicken Bites with Rigatoni in Alfredo Sauce is a flavor-rich, creamy pasta dish topped with crisp, seasoned chicken bites. Perfectly coated rigatoni soaks in velvety Alfredo sauce, while garlic butter-crusted chicken adds the ultimate savory crunch. A comforting, indulgent dinner that’s perfect for both weeknights and special occasions.


Ingredients

1 lb chicken breast, cut into bite-sized pieces

8 oz rigatoni pasta

2 tablespoons butter (for chicken)

3 cloves garlic, minced

1 teaspoon Italian seasoning

1 cup panko breadcrumbs

1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ese

1 cup heavy cream

1 tablespoon olive oil

Salt to taste

Black pepper to taste

1/2 teaspoon red pepper flakes (optional)

2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ped


Instructions

1. Cut chicken into bite-sized pieces and season with salt, pepper, and Italian seasoning.

2. Dredge chicken in a mixture of panko breadcrumbs and Parmesan.

3. Heat olive oil and 1 tablespoon butter in a skillet. Cook chicken until golden and crispy. Set aside.

4. In a large pot, boil salted water and cook rigatoni until al dente. Drain and reserve 1/4 cup pasta water.

5. In a saucepan, melt remaining butter and sauté garlic until fragrant.

6. Pour in heavy cream and bring to a gentle simmer.

7. Stir in Parmesan and mix until smooth. Thin with pasta water if needed.

8. Toss rigatoni in the Alfredo sauce.

9. Plate the pasta and top with garlic butter chicken. Garnish with red pepper flakes and parsley.

10. Serve immediately for best texture.

Notes

Use freshly grated Parmesan for the smoothest Alfredo sauce.

Don’t overcrowd the skillet when frying chicken to maintain crispiness.

To reheat, add a splash of milk to keep the sauce from drying out.
